The Jaqua Concert Hall at the Shedd Institute is a true gem for music lovers in Eugene, especially those passionate about Beethoven Eugene concerts. It’s a cozy yet acoustically superb space that feels more like a living room than a typical concert hall, making every performance feel intimate and special. The venue draws a dedicated crowd who come back year after year, eager to experience everything from classical masterpieces to innovative new works. They often feature pre-concert music that sets the mood, and some nights even include interactive elements where the audience gets a chance to engage or ask questions, kind of like being part of the performance. What really sets it apart is how they work with artists to tweak the space, ensuring every note resonates perfectly. Plus, the Shedd Institute offers excellent programs, including music classes and training sessions, making it more than just a concert venue, it’s a hub for cultivating the local music scene.
